Position Description
The Manager, Quality Assurance and Operations plays a key role in advancing divisional transformation, operational excellence, and continuous improvement across Social Services. The position provides strategic oversight of quality assurance frameworks, administrative operations, and divisional workplans, ensuring alignment with provincial mandates, corporate priorities, and service delivery standards. Through data-informed decision-making and cross-functional collaboration, the Manager drives innovation, service integration, and performance accountability across a broad range of programs.
As a people leader, the Manager supervises a team of 13 unionized staff and fosters a culture of excellence, adaptability, and continuous learning. The role provides strategic direction, supports staff development, and ensures effective coordination across administrative, quality assurance, and training functions. By developing staff, guiding performance, and modelling collaborative leadership, the Manager contributes to a resilient, high-performing division that delivers responsive and equitable services to the community.
Qualifications and Other Pertinent Details
Requires a university degree in Business Administration, Public or Health Administration, Human Services, or an approved equivalent combination of education and experience. A minimum of five years of progressive leadership experience in social services is required, including strategic planning, operational oversight, and performance management. Experience in a municipal or provincial government setting is preferred. Candidates must demonstrate advanced skills in project planning, business process development, change management, and service delivery within a human services environment. Strong leadership, team-building, and management capabilities are essential, along with a proven ability to apply core competencies such as customer service and continuous improvement. A professional designation or certification in quality assurance, continuous improvement, or public sector leadership is considered an asset.
Must be able to work independently using diplomacy and sound judgement. Must have a good working knowledge of word processing, spreadsheet, and presentation software applications. Must have an understanding and working knowledge of performance, change and conflict resolution management systems and strategies. Must possess creative/innovative focus on service delivery; a commitment to customer service and continuous improvement; a respect for the diversity of opinions, perspectives, and ideas; and be comfortable with a certain level of ambiguity and changing priorities and demands. Requires excellent communication and public relations skills to develop positive working relationship within the Corporation, with other Consolidated Municipal Service Manager (CMSMs), with service agencies and the community. Must have a valid Driver’s licence and provide own transportation to fulfil the responsibilities of the position. Frequent local travel to fulfil the requirements of the position is required.
